Designed by Arne Jacobsen

The fixture emits soft comfortable light. The glass is designed to provide a uniformly lit surface.

The three-layer mouth-blown opal glass shade has a transparent edge, providing a decorative halo of light around the fixture.

THE STORY BEHIND THE PRODUCT

AJ Eklipta was designed by Arne Jacobsen in 1959 for Rødovre Town Hall. Two different sizes were produced for this project – 350 mm and 450 mm. They were used indoors on stairways and outdoors as wall lamps. A 220 mm version was later designed for St. Catherine’s College in England. When Arne Jacobsen used the fixture himself on stairways he always preferred the largest model. The fixture is being used around the world today in a variety of architectural contexts.

DESIGNER - ARNE JACOBSEN

Arne jacobsen was born and raised in copenhagen. In 1927, he graduated as an architect from the royal danish academy of fine arts in copenhagen. After graduating, he obtained his first job at the office of the city architect of copenhagen launching his own office only two years later.
